Query 1: What’s the approximate flight distance between Houston and Chicago?
The flight distance between Houston (usually George Bush Intercontinental Airport – IAH) and Chicago (usually O’Hare Worldwide Airport – ORD) is roughly 940 miles.
Query 2: How lengthy does a direct flight usually take to cowl this distance?
A continuous flight between Houston and Chicago usually takes round two hours. Nevertheless, precise flight instances can range because of components like climate situations and air visitors management.
Query 3: How does this distance affect ticket costs?
The gap contributes to the bottom value of a ticket because of gas consumption. Longer distances usually correlate with larger gas prices, impacting total ticket costs. Seasonal demand and competitors between airways additionally play important roles in figuring out remaining ticket prices.
Query 4: Are connecting flights out there on this route, and the way do they examine to direct flights?
Connecting flights can be found and should typically provide decrease fares than direct flights. Nevertheless, connecting itineraries introduce further journey time because of layovers and the chance of potential delays.
Query 5: How does this distance have an effect on gas consumption and environmental influence?
The 940-mile distance necessitates a considerable quantity of gas, contributing to the flight’s carbon footprint. Airways repeatedly attempt to optimize gas effectivity to mitigate environmental influence and operational prices.
Query 6: What are the first airports serving this route?
The primary airports serving this route are George Bush Intercontinental Airport (IAH) in Houston and O’Hare Worldwide Airport (ORD) in Chicago. Different airports, similar to William P. Passion Airport (HOU) in Houston and Chicago Halfway Worldwide Airport (MDW), may provide service, however usually with connecting flights.
